Finance Director for Construction Company

Your new company
Working for a unique SME company based in Southampton, this is a unique opportunity to become part of an organisation that is on the up.

Your new role
This is a truly exciting time to join the organisation at a key stage in their development. You'll be joining into a fantastic company reporting directly to the Managing Director

As part of your role, you will contribute to the ongoing strategic programme, helping to maximise existing investments and make the best and most effective decisions moving forwards. Upon starting with the business, you will assume responsibility for all finance matters, IT development and everything related to corporate governance including Company Secretarial duties. As a key post holder within the organisation, you'll work closely with the MD and Chair to drive the business forwards into the next stage of their development.

Inheriting a small, established team, you will be supported by a Finance Manager as well as an Accounts & IT Assistant and two transactional staff members (including payroll). This is supported by two part-time administrators. Full support will be given to shape and develop this in-line with future business needs.

You will be a key commercial spearhead, working closely in partnership with the MD to take the business forwards, providing ideas, strategic insight and challenging where appropriate to drive change.

Key duties and responsibilities:
Finance:

  • Develop and implement financial and accounting strategies & policies across all aspects of the current business.
  • Provide analysis and advice to the Board on the financial and risk management aspects of future investments and developments.
  • Accountable for the development, analysis and reporting of the company's management accounting information for Board.
  • Ensure compliance and best practice with all Financial Accounting and Audit requirements.

IT:

  • Recommend strategies to develop the IT capability of the company in line with the growth and development ambitions for the business. eg. 'E-commerce ready'.
  • Ensure IT operations fully support the day to day running of all aspects the business.
  • Provide operational support (help desk) capability for all members of staff, with current and future IT applications.



What you'll need to succeed
You will be a qualified accountant with a minimum of 5 years relevant experience at a similar seniority level.

This role is well suited to a commercially driven, strategic finance professional who enjoys 'rolling up their sleeves' and spearheading change for growth. You will have demonstrable experience in IT & systems development in an operational business environment, with previous experience of overseeing both finance and non-finance functions (particularly IT, and HR would be preferable but not essential).

Alongside the above, the business are seeking an individual who ideally has a brad spectrum of operating at Board level within a similar sized and structured environment but also with a strong operational background. This may be well suited to someone who has worked as a Portfolio FD previously.
